Hi All, I am looking at my 2nd PC Build and have the following in mind;

£159.98 - Intel Core i5-2500K 3.30GHz
£131.99 - Asus P8Z68-V Intel Z68 Motherboard
£119.99 - OcUK ATI Radeon HD 6870 1024MB GDDR5
£65.99 - Antec TruePower New Modular 650W '80 Plus Bronze'
£57.59 - Corsair XMS3 8GB (2x4GB) DDR3 PC3-12800C9 1600MHz Kit
£44.99 - Antec 300 Three Hundred Ultimate Gaming Case - Black
£139.99 - Crucial RealSSD M4 128GB 2.5" SATA 6Gb/s

Total : £750.52

This will be mainly for gaming and 3D graphics work. I have optical and storage drives in my current build I can reuse so was considering my first ever SSD.
